July 12, 2026Under 0.5 goals is a popular football betting market that focuses on the total number of goals scored in a match. Specifically, it predicts whether less than one goal will be scored across both teams combined. It’s a very niche bet, appealing to those seeking high-risk, high-reward opportunities, or those anticipating exceptionally tight, defensive encounters.
How Does it Work?
The bet is incredibly straightforward. You are essentially betting on whether no goals will be scored during the 90 minutes of regular play (plus any added time). Here’s a breakdown:
- Winning Bet: If the match ends 0-0, your bet wins.
- Losing Bet: If even a single goal is scored (1-0, 2-0, 1-1, etc.), your bet loses.
It’s crucial to remember that this bet doesn’t consider extra time or penalty shootouts. Only goals scored within the standard 90 minutes + injury time count.
Why Choose Under 0.5 Goals?
Several factors make this market attractive to certain bettors:
- High Odds: Due to the low probability of a goalless match, under 0.5 goals bets typically offer significantly higher odds than more common markets like Over/Under 2.5 goals.
- Defensive Focus: It’s ideal for matches where both teams are known for strong defensive records and a lack of attacking prowess.
- Tactical Approaches: Games where a draw is a good result for both teams (e.g., in tournament group stages) often see cautious, defensive tactics employed.
- Low-Scoring Leagues: Some football leagues are inherently low-scoring. Betting on under 0.5 goals can be a viable strategy in these leagues.
Factors to Consider Before Betting
While tempting, under 0.5 goals bets require careful consideration:
- Team Form: Analyze recent matches. Are both teams consistently failing to score?
- Head-to-Head Record: Have previous encounters between these teams been low-scoring affairs?
- Key Players: Are any key attacking players injured or suspended?
- Managerial Tactics: What are the managers’ preferred styles of play? Are they known for defensive solidity?
- Motivation: Is there a strong incentive for either team to attack and win?

Risks Involved
The primary risk is the low probability of success. Football is unpredictable, and even defensively-minded teams can concede a goal. It’s a high-variance bet, meaning results can swing dramatically. Don’t stake large amounts on this market.
